引言
在Ubuntu體系中,eth0作為傳統的收集接口名,在很多收集設置成績中扮演着重要角色。但是,偶然用戶會發明他們的體系里找不到eth0網卡。這種情況可能會給收集連接帶來費事。本文將深刻探究Ubuntu體系中找不到eth0的原因,並供給響應的處理打算。
原因分析
1. 體系版本更新
隨着Linux內核的更新,收集命名標準產生了變更。在某些版本中,默許的收集接口名已從eth0變為enp0s3等。假如體系版本更新,可能會呈現找不到eth0的情況。
2. 收集接口卡破壞或未安裝
假如收集接口卡破壞或未正確安裝,體系可能無法辨認eth0網卡。
3. 收集設置錯誤
收集設置錯誤,如收集接口名設置錯誤,也可能招致找不到eth0網卡。
4. 收集效勞未啟動
收集效勞未啟動或未正確設置,也可能招致找不到eth0網卡。
處理打算
1. 檢查體系版本
起首,檢查妳的Ubuntu體系版本。假如體系版本較新,可能須要調劑收集接口名。可能經由過程以下命令檢查體系版本:
lsb_release -a
2. 檢查收集接口卡
檢查收集接口卡能否破壞或未正確安裝。假如須要,請重新安裝或調換收集接口卡。
3. 檢查收集設置
檢查收集設置,確保收集接口名設置正確。可能利用以下命令檢查收集接口設置:
ifconfig -a
或
ip addr show
假如找不到eth0,可能實驗將其設置為默許接口。編輯/etc/network/interfaces
文件,將以下內容增加到文件中:
auto eth0
iface eth0 inet dhcp
然後,重啟收集效勞:
sudo systemctl restart networking
4. 啟動收集效勞
確保收集效勞已啟動。可能利用以下命令啟動收集效勞:
sudo systemctl start networking
5. 生成eth0設置文件
假如體系不eth0網卡設置文件,可妙手動創建一個。起首,進入網卡設置存放地位:
cd /etc/sysconfig/network-scripts/
然後,利用以下命令創建eth0設置文件:
sudo cp ifcfg-lo ifcfg-eth0
編輯ifcfg-eth0
文件,填上基本的收集參數,比方IP地點、子網掩碼跟網關等。保存並封閉文件。
最後,重啟收集效勞:
sudo systemctl restart networking
總結
找不到eth0網卡的情況可能由多種原因招致。經由過程分析成績原因並採取響應的處理打算,可能輕鬆處理這個成績。在處理收集設置成績時,請務必細心檢查每一步,以確保收集設置正確無誤。